Our Drain Cleaning Process

A clear, professional approach to drain cleaning — tailored to your Town and Country property.

1

Drain Inspection

Magnet Plumbing assesses every drain cleaning job in Town and Country, WA before starting work. For main sewer lines and recurring clogs, we use video inspection to see the exact obstruction type and location so we select the right clearing method.

2

Drain Clearing

Our Town and Country plumber clears your drain using professional equipment. Kitchen drains with grease buildup benefit from hydro-jetting, while bathroom clogs typically respond well to mechanical snaking. We use the method that clears the obstruction completely.

3

Flow Verification

After clearing, we run water through the drain to verify full flow is restored and confirm no secondary blockages are present further down the line.

4

Prevention Advice

Magnet Plumbing closes every drain cleaning job in Town and Country, WA with practical prevention advice tailored to what caused your clog. We recommend the right maintenance intervals and any improvements — like root barrier treatments or trap upgrades — that reduce recurrence.

How often should I have my drains professionally cleaned in Town and Country?

Most Town and Country homeowners benefit from professional drain cleaning every 1 to 2 years as preventive maintenance. Kitchen drains in households that cook frequently may need annual service. Homes with large trees near the sewer line should have the main line inspected and cleared annually to prevent root buildup from causing backups.

Is it safe to use chemical drain cleaners in my Town and Country home?

Chemical drain cleaners are generally not recommended for Town and Country homes with older plumbing. The caustic chemicals can accelerate corrosion in metal pipes and degrade older PVC joints over time. They also rarely clear blockages completely and can make the problem worse by causing debris to compact. Professional drain cleaning by Magnet Plumbing is safer and more effective.

Can tree roots damage my sewer line in Town and Country?

Yes. Tree roots are one of the most common causes of sewer line problems in Town and Country neighborhoods with mature trees. Roots enter through small cracks or joints in older sewer lines and grow inside the pipe, eventually causing recurring blockages, complete blockages, or pipe collapse. Annual hydro-jetting and a root treatment can control root growth and extend line life.
